Differences between 1st and 2nd editions The Portland Handbook was originally published in November 2000. Over the next two years, we monitored the many changes to phone numbers, website address, postage and social security rate changes, and the details of recent additions to Tri-Met and Max services (Portland area public transportation). The newly revised 2nd edition was released in November 2002.

>INS Reorganization

INS Reorganization, Chapter 13 Legal Matters, particularly pages 293-298.

Effective March 1, 2003, the functions of the U.S. Immigration and Naturalization Service (INS) became part of the new Department of Homeland Security. The INS is now called the Bureau of Citizenship and Immigration Services (BCIS). The offices, employees, procedures and paperwork will remain the same. As stated in the book, the Portland office is at 511 NW Broadway, their telephone number is 1-800-375-5283. The INS website we list on page 293 will direct you to the new BCIS website at www.immigration.gov.
